Popular Xbox Series X games (Indie) Week 46 2023 - 121 weeks ago

The Last Faith
Xbox Series X
Nov 15
Coral Island
Xbox Series X
Nov 14
Tanks, But No Tanks
Xbox Series X
Nov 14
Super Crazy Rhythm Castle
Xbox Series X
Nov 14
Lake ‘Season's Greetings’
Xbox Series X
Nov 15
Lily in Puzzle World
Xbox Series X
Nov 15
Lake - Season's Greetings
Xbox Series X
Nov 15